Key Types of Drill Rigs and Their Applications
Different drilling projects call for different types of rigs. Understanding the main categories helps you narrow down the options and avoid costly mismatches.
Portable Water Well Drilling Rigs
For water well drilling in remote or hard-to-access locations, portability is a critical factor. Hydraulic portable diesel engine water well drill rigs are designed to be transported easily and set up quickly. These rigs typically offer drilling depths of up to 100 to 200 meters, making them suitable for community water supply projects, agricultural irrigation, and rural development. Their diesel-powered engines provide reliable performance without dependence on grid electricity — a major advantage in off-grid locations.
Core Sampling Rigs
Geological exploration and mineral prospecting rely on core sampling to understand subsurface conditions. Portable core sampling rigs are engineered specifically for extracting intact rock cores from various depths. These rigs work in tandem with diamond core bits, including impregnated, surface set, and electroplated varieties, to cut through hard rock and retrieve high-quality samples for laboratory analysis. Factors to Consider When Selecting a Drill Rig
Once you have identified the general type of rig needed, several technical and operational factors should guide your final decision:
- Drilling depth requirements: The target depth of your borehole is the most fundamental parameter. Portable rigs typically cover depths from 30 to 200 meters, while larger truck-mounted units can reach much deeper. Match the rig’s rated depth to your project’s maximum requirement with a reasonable margin.
- Formation hardness and geology: The type of rock or soil you will encounter determines the drilling method and the compatible tooling. Soft formations like clay and sandstone can be drilled with carbide drag bits, while hard rock formations require pdc drill bit technology or diamond-impregnated core bits for effective penetration.
- Access and terrain: If the drilling site is on a steep slope, in a dense forest, or accessible only by narrow paths, a compact, portable rig is essential. Consider the transport method — can the rig be carried by a small truck, or does it need to be disassembled and carried by hand?
- Power source availability: In remote locations, diesel-powered rigs are the most practical choice. Electric rigs, while quieter and cleaner, require a reliable power supply that may not be available on-site.
- Water and mud circulation: Most drilling operations require a mud pump to circulate drilling fluid for cooling, lubrication, and cuttings removal. Ensure the rig is compatible with the mud pump and circulation system you plan to use.
The Importance of Matching the Rig to the Tooling
A drill rig is only as effective as the tooling it powers. The rotary power head, drill rods, and the drill bit at the bottom of the hole must all work together as an integrated system. For example, a rig equipped with a high-torque rotary head can efficiently drive a large-diameter PDC bit through medium-hard formations, while a rig with a lower-torque head may struggle and cause premature bit wear. When purchasing a rig, consider the full range of tooling you will need — including drill pipes, bits, reaming shells, and core barrels — and ensure compatibility across the entire string.
